Choosing the Right Number of Spots

One of the most critical decisions a new mobile player faces is determining how many numbers to select per ticket. While most games allow you to pick up to 10 or 15 numbers, choosing too many can reduce your probability of hitting a high percentage of matches. Conversely, picking too few numbers keeps the top rewards modest but offers more frequent lower-tier returns.

A balanced strategy for beginners is to focus on selecting between four and eight numbers during early sessions. This range provides a reasonable balance between risk and potential payout without exhausting your bankroll too quickly. Experimenting with different amounts will help you discover which pace of gameplay suits your entertainment preferences best.

Pacing Your Sessions Responsibly

Mobile devices make it incredibly easy to start a new round instantly, which significantly increases the speed of the draws compared to land-based environments. Because of this rapid nature, it is easy to lose track of time and spend more than initially intended. Setting a firm session limit before you open the application is an excellent way to maintain healthy gaming habits.

Taking short breaks between drawings can also help keep the experience relaxed and enjoyable rather than rushed. Remember that every round relies on independent random number generators, so past draws have no bearing on future outcomes. Focus on viewing each game as a separate form of casual entertainment rather than a predictable sequence.
